Aaron Krickstein and
Christophe Roger-Vasselin have met 1 time. Aaron Krickstein currently holds the upper hand, leading the series 1β0.
Looking at their individual career profiles, Aaron Krickstein has compiled an overall career record of 395β256 across 651 matches, translating to a win rate of 60.68%. On hard courts his record stands at 213β113 (65.34%), while on clay he holds a 122β86 (58.65%) mark. On grass the numbers read 12β9 (57.14%) , and on carpet 48β48 (50.00%). Throughout his career he has won 9 titles (6 hard, 2 clay, 1 carpet). Against Top 10 opponents his record reads 19β59 (24.36%).
Christophe Roger-Vasselin, on the other hand, enters this matchup with a career mark of 91β131 from 222 matches (40.99% win rate). His hard-court record is 30β35 (46.15%), on clay he stands at 52β65 (44.44%), and on grass he has gone 2β8 (20.00%) , with a carpet record of 7β23 (23.33%). Against Top 10 opponents his record stands at 1β13 (7.14%).
When it comes to their head-to-head meetings, the surface breakdown reveals this contrast. The clay record between them sits at 1β0 (100.00% for Aaron Krickstein) across 1 matches.
